Transaction 1e31ae1bdbe8999206e60b6079e59639a3a13dbeb359a1b03b56d0e4bd65b7cc

1 Input
2 Outputs
  • 1e31ae1bdbe8999206e60b6079e59639a3a13dbeb359a1b03b56d0e4bd65b7cc:0
  • value  20000000
    address  3FE1RgBb69M8MAgUWS8kNxvMFz3Va9UUMh
  • 1e31ae1bdbe8999206e60b6079e59639a3a13dbeb359a1b03b56d0e4bd65b7cc:1
  • value  10267957
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n